The Best Times to Visit Colleges
There are several factors to consider when deciding when to visit colleges. Here are a few things to keep in mind:
When Are Colleges Most Likely to Be Open?
Most colleges have regular business hours, typically Monday through Friday, 8:00 am to 5:00 pm. However, some colleges may have limited hours or be closed during certain times of the year. It’s essential to check the college’s website or contact their admissions office to confirm their hours before planning a visit.
When Are Colleges Less Busy?
Visiting a college during less busy times can make for a more relaxed and personalized experience. Consider visiting during the following times:
- During the week, especially on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ays
- During the spring semester, when students are on spring break or mid-terms
- During the summer months, when students are on summer break

What to Expect During a College Visit
When planning a college visit, it’s essential to know what to expect. Here are a few things to keep in mind:
What to Wear
It’s a good idea to dress professionally for a college visit. This will show respect for the college and its staff, and will also help you feel more confident and prepared. What to Bring
It’s a good idea to bring a few things with you on a college visit:
- A list of questions to ask the admissions staff
- A copy of your transcript and test scores
- A list of your extracurricular activities and volunteer work
- A notebook and pen to take notes
What to Expect During a Campus Tour
A campus tour is a great way to get a feel for the college and learn more about its programs and facilities. Here are a few things to expect during a campus tour:
- A guided tour of the campus, including the student union, library, and residence halls
- A chance to ask questions and get a sense of the college’s culture and community
- A look at the college’s facilities, including the gym, dining hall, and recreational spaces
Tips for Making the Most of Your College Visit
Here are a few tips for making the most of your college visit:
Do Your Research
Before visiting a college, do your research and learn as much as you can about the college. This will help you ask informed questions and get a better sense of whether the college is a good fit for you.
Be Prepared to Ask Questions
When visiting a college, it’s essential to be prepared to ask questions. This will help you get a better sense of the college and its programs, and will also show that you’re interested in attending the college.
Take Notes

Follow Up
After visiting a college, be sure to follow up with the admissions staff. This will help you stay top of mind and will also give you a chance to ask any additional questions you may have.
